电子指南针GY-26详细资料及C程序(IIC和串口两种方式)
2022-03-21 15:55:21 218KB GY-26 IIC 串口 C语言
1
一句话梳理流程 stm32模拟硬件IIC时序,按照时序,EEPROM识别外部信号,完成对其的数据操作 目的: 使用32开发板软件模拟IIC实现对带有硬件IIC接口的eeprom完成写数据并将写入的数据读出来,内容显示到TFTLCD 硬件需求及连接: STM32精英开发板 板载的eeprom(容量256K) TFTLCD显示屏 为什么不使用硬件IIC 目前大部分 MCU 都带有 IIC 总线接口,但是这里我们不使用 STM32的硬件 IIC 来读写 24C02,而是通过软件模拟。STM32 的硬件 IIC 非常复杂,更重要的是不稳定,故不推荐使用。所以我们这里就通过模拟来实现了。有兴趣的读
2022-03-19 19:31:08 205KB 24c02 c eeprom
1
STM32硬件IIC
2022-03-18 14:26:51 7KB STM32 IIC 硬件IIC
1
Proteus8.9的VSM Studio使用的SDCC仿真_STC15W4k32S4_013_iic_04_AT24C16编程代码和仿真操作实验
2022-03-16 17:10:22 171KB Proteus C51 SDCC AT24C016
1
0.96OLED显示屏适用于STM32F103C8T6_IIC通信 有需要的自行下载 0.96OLED显示屏STM32F103C8T6_IIC
2022-03-15 15:01:09 293KB 0.96OLED STM32F103C8T6 IIC通信
1
STM32F103VET6模拟IIC方式操作EEPROM。
2022-03-13 12:54:42 1.57MB STM32 IIC EEPROM
1
0 引言   嵌入式开发中,常见的通信接口/协议有SPI,I2C,UART三种,本文先分三个部分对SPI,I2C,UART进行介绍,最后对这三种协议进行比较。   1 SPI 1.1 SPI的简介   SPI(Serial Peripheral Interface):串行外围设备接口。SPI是一种高速的,全双工的,同步的通信总线。SPI没有定义速度限制,一般的实现通常能达到甚至超过10 Mbps,已知的有的器件SPI已达到50Mbps。 1.2 SPI接口的引脚 MOSI(Master Out Slave In):主设备数据输出,从设备数据输入 MISO(Master In Slave
2022-03-07 14:30:59 140KB i2c总线协议 iic spi
1
基于STM32F4芯片HAL库,main中创建任务sht_task,如果没有使用系统,可以把sht_task任务直接改成main函数,初始化调用iic1_init()。 实际用的SHT20,非主机模式采集温度。 这个是硬件IIC操作SHT20,比较简单,得其他用途。这不是完整工程。
2022-03-07 06:09:10 5.07MB SHT20 硬件IIC
1
总结IIC通信协议,很好地学习资料,你值得一看!
2022-03-05 16:28:10 32KB IIC
1
BQ34Z100 IIC 参考文件.pdf
2022-03-03 22:40:42 54KB BQ34Z100
1